Master in Law, Governance & Technology

State-recognised Master’s degree, in agreement with Toulouse Capitole University


The Master in Law, Governance and Technology prepares students to become involved in the governance of digital technologies in companies, public institutions or any sector of social life. Thanks to the combination of a solid legal training based on the development of skills in technology, human sciences and project development, students will then be capable of responding thoughtfully to the challenges of the digital transition.
This programme trains agile lawyers, capable of adapting, anticipating and creating the digital society of tomorrow, in a pragmatic, responsible and imaginative way.

Programme highlights

Academic Excellence

  • A truly international curriculum: Master’s 1 is bilingual (English & French), while Master’s 2 is fully taught in English, preparing students for global career opportunities and academic research in an international setting.
  • High quality teaching: Courses are delivered by leading international scholars and digital transformation experts, providing cutting-edge knowledge and insights.
  • Interdisciplinary depth: A rigorous approach to the human sciences enables students to critically analyze the legal, ethical, political, and social dimensions of digital transformation.
  • A research-driven environment: Regular research seminars and academic conferences, offering students direct engagement with pioneering scholars and practitioners.
  • Specialized elective modules: Customizable learning paths allow students to specialize in key areas
  • A hands-on approach bridging theory and practice: Academic knowledge is reinforced through case studies, simulations, and problem-based learning, ensuring a deep, applied understanding of real-world challenges.
  • Experiential learning formats promoting critical thinking, autonomy, and creativity: group projects, studios, incubators, hackathons, and dynamic seminars.

Professional Development

  • Advanced technological and digital training to lead digital transformation projects across private and public sectors.
  • Development of business acumen and professional skills, with a focus on the evolving legal profession.
  • Hands-on experience in project management and entrepreneurial innovation, including start-up creation in collaboration with the FLD Incubator.
  • A sector-specific internship between Master’s 1 and Master’s 2 to gain real-world experience.
  • Exclusive access to an international network of academics and professionals from both public and private sectors.
  • Strong research training, paving the way for a PhD in France or internationally.
  • Personalized career guidance and mentorship through our Career Center.
